The bridge was built with 16 huge chain cables – each consisting of 935 iron bars – to support the 579-foot (176.5-meter)-long main span. One essential thing in the plans was to have clearance of a hundred feet below the bridge, to allow tall sailing ships, very popular on the Menai, to sail underneath unhindered. But it swayed alarmingly in severe winds and had to be repaired in minor and major ways on several occasions, before Telford's original chains were replaced by stronger ones in 1940. The suspended central span of 176.5m is flanked by stone approach spans of 15.8m, three on the Bangor side and four at the Menai Bridge (Porthaethwy) end. This puzzle marks a 75th anniversary. The Menai Suspension Bridge reduced the travel time between Anglesey and London from 36 to 27 hours. The bridge is 304.8m long and 45.7m high overall, and carries the road 30.5m above sea level, allowing tall sailing ships to pass beneath. Designed by Thomas Telford and completed in 1826 this Grade I listed bridge, over the Menai Strait, was built to link mainland of Wales to the island of Anglesey and provide a safer and quicker journey from London to Holyhead.
